A motorist received a violation ticket today for failing to move for an
emergency vehicle.
Sergeant Blaine Gervais of the Oliver RCMP reported that the driver of a
vehicle did not move for emergency personnel while members were
dealing with a collision scene on Highway 97 at Gallagher Lake this
morning.
“Oliver RCMP would like to remind other drivers to slow down when they
see emergency vehicles with lights activated on the roadway,” Gervais
said.
The commander explained that police attended a two-vehicle collision
between a semi truck and a small car. The semi was in the passing lane
heading north while the car was in the slow lane, also heading north.
Weather conditions included deep slushy snow on the roadway, Gervais
noted.
A collision occurred between the semi unit and the car, with the car
crossing the oncoming lanes and striking a concrete barrier on the west
side of the highway, causing extensive damage.
No injuries occurred as a result of the collision.
